Six-year-old girl missing near Burns Lake, B.C., since Thursday found safe

September 23, 2024
A six-year-old girl who had been missing from her community in north-central British Columbia since Thursday has been found safe.Resources from across the province were enlisted in the search to find the child who lives in a small community not far from Burns Lake.The girl, who is on the autism spectrum and non-verbal, was found on Sunday night around 6 p.m.
